Cat stuck in tree in Dexter for more than a week

Cat stuck in tree in Dexter for more than a week

DEXTER, MO (KFVS) - Dexter's Animal Control Officer tried a harrowing rescue attempt for a little guy who is far away from home.

A black and white cat has been stuck some 65 feet in a tree in Dexter for more than a week.

The very tall tree is in the 800 block of North Hickory.

Dexter's Animal Control Officer tried to coax the cat down.  Then, he used a hose off a fire department brush truck to try and convince him to climb down.

The water actually sent the cat up even higher in the tree.

Let's hope he's got all nine lives because at last report, he was still stuck in the tree.
